3. Pricing Trends and Reimbursement Landscape
-
Initial Pricing:
Historically, innovative biologics command high launch prices, often exceeding $100,000 annually [2].
-
Biosimilar Competition:
Entry of biosimilars often pressure prices downward over 5-7 years.
-
Reimbursement Dynamics:
CMS and private insurers prioritize cost-effectiveness, influencing net prices.
